Transaction 80a85b73bdecb4f94d96388dd388a2bce314b47e03ab7634ee910e691d1165f7

6 Input
2 Outputs
  • 80a85b73bdecb4f94d96388dd388a2bce314b47e03ab7634ee910e691d1165f7:0
  • value  1744290
    address  3FxgHsAHzc8ETnANkyAiWcmftHGqxcZGDZ
  • 80a85b73bdecb4f94d96388dd388a2bce314b47e03ab7634ee910e691d1165f7:1
  • value  1000184
    address  3LDYwXQ7SN2YYLdnyhSL2H8EmPWEGreVLv